Data Analyst Position Summary:

The Certified Clinical Behavioral Health Clinic (CCBHC) Data Analyst position is responsible for providing critical analytical support to Integrated Healthcare projects, particularly, to CCBHC quality measures.

The CCBHC Data Analyst assists the Director in coordination, collection, interpretation and analysis of data.

This employee will also work with other QI Projects to monitor and benchmark cost, utilization and other quality and performance indicators; monitor for adverse trends; recommend modifications and corrective action; assist quality improvement project teams in design and implementation.

This position works with IT to identify solutions and meet deadlines associated critical data processes.

Data Analyst Responsibilities:  


* Data collection, analysis, and reporting.


* Develop strategies to improve data collection and outcome improvement.


* Analyzes QI data to support the QI department in identifying opportunities for improvement, e.g., analyzing performance trends and variation by key demographic strata.


* Analyze and evaluate various sources of data in support of internal customers to improve quality and further the goals and objectives of the organization.


* Monitors and analyzes outcomes to ensure goals, objectives, outcomes, accreditation and regulatory requirements are met.


* Produce and analyze reports that monitor and benchmark cost, utilization and other quality and performance indicators.


* Monitor for adverse trends, recommend modifications and corrective action.


* Identify and implement standardized monitoring tools to oversee quality.


* Communicates programs, interventions and results to external entities in accordance with applicable program objectives, policies and procedures.


* Research best practices, national and regional benchmarks, and industry standards.
